The decision to drop the atomic bomb was intended to accomplish which goal(s)?
ollegr [7]

Answer:

c. The decision to drop the atomic bomb was to end WW II quickly

Explanation:

The decision to use the atomic bomb on Japan was in order to end the World War II quickly and efficiently. By using the atomic bomb, the United States wanted to destroy Japan as soon as possible, as the fighting on land that was going on, even though it was successful, still it was slow and there were lot of casualties on the side of the United States and their allies. By eliminating Japan as a threat, the US forces would have been able to move to Europe and together with the Allies to finish off Germany, and so it was.
